Claus Thorp Hansen is a scholar working on Mechanical Engineering, Management of Technology and Innovation and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Claus Thorp Hansen has authored 44 papers receiving a total of 453 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 24 papers in Mechanical Engineering, 18 papers in Management of Technology and Innovation and 11 papers in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ering. Recurrent topics in Claus Thorp Hansen's work include Design Education and Practice (23 papers), Product Development and Customization (18 papers) and Manufacturing Process and Optimization (11 papers). Claus Thorp Hansen is often cited by papers focused on Design Education and Practice (23 papers), Product Development and Customization (18 papers) and Manufacturing Process and Optimization (11 papers). Claus Thorp Hansen collaborates with scholars based in Denmark, Sweden and Finland. Claus Thorp Hansen's co-authors include Mogens Myrup Andreasen, Philip Cash, Zhe Zhang, Michael A. E. Andersen, Hans Bruun Nielsen, Kaj Madsen, Niels Henrik Mortensen, Saeema Ahmed‐Kristensen, Thomas Jensen and Christian Clausen and has published in prestigious journals such as Mathematical Programming, Research in Engineering Design and IEEE Transactions on Education.
